Lecture Series: Creating Buzzworthy Gardens-Successful Pollinator Habitats

Speaker: Anne Spafford - Professor of Landscape Design, Department of Horticulture Science, NC State University

Residential gardens can play a huge role in providing much needed habitat, food and water supplies, and nesting places for pollinators. No garden is too small to make a difference. With over 40 million acres of lawn in the United States alone, there is ample opportunity to make room for pollinator habitat. While there is much concern for the plight of pollinators, many homeowners are unaware or unsure how they can help, and are perhaps concerned about the landscape aesthetics of a pollinator habitat.
